2010 finance offers on Mercedes C-Class

A REVISED Mercedes C-Class is on the way next year, but there is still time to take advantage of deals on the existing model as Mercedes prepare to clear stocks ahead of the new car’s arrival.

This deal caught our eye: a manual Mercedes C 180 CGI BlueEFFICIENCY Executive SE Saloon for just L319 a month on contract hire following an initial three months down-payment of L957.

The Executive SE spec includes styling enhancements such as the Sport grille and chrome trim on the boot lid and tailpipe, as well as 16inch alloy wheels and the very easy to use COMAND navigation system with hard-disk navigation. Mercedes says the extras included in the price save you L2,200 compared to purchasing the equipment separately.

This particular C-Class has CO2 emissions of 157g/km, which means a company car tax rate of 20% for this financial year, rising to 21% in the 2011/12 tax year. Tax payable at 40% is L2015 this year rising to L2116 in 2011/12. Average fuel consumption is 42.2mpg.

Other C-Class offers available through Mercedes-Benz include:

  • C 200 CDI BlueEFFICIENCY Executive SE Saloon auto, L299
  • C 200 CDI BlueEFFICIENCY Sport Saloon manual, L309
  • C 250 CDI BlueEFFICIENCY Sport Saloon auto, L385

You might have to hurry, though, to register your interest because the offer currently expires on 31 December.

Editor’s note: Mercedes refers to these deals as an ‘operating lease’. This is the same as a contract hire agreement.
